Why Phyllis George Decided She Would Never Say Never

from Now I've Heard Everything · host Bill Thompson

Phyllis George won the title in 1971, representing Texas in the pageant. Just four years later, she was hired by CBS Sports, to co-host The NFL Today. And four years after that, she became First Lady of Kentucky when her husband John Y. Brown was elected Governor. In this 2002 interview George talks about her successes and how you can achieve your own dreams.
